2025 Fantasy Outlook
Early in his career, it looked like Wennberg might be a significant offensive contributor. He had 59 points in his age-22 season back in 2016-17. However, he hasn’t reached the 40-point mark since and has recorded between 30-38 points in each of his past four seasons. Now 30 years old (31 on Sept. 22), the hope of him becoming an offensive force is well in the rear-view mirror. He was limited to 10 goals and 35 points across 77 appearances with San Jose last season despite averaging 18:51 of ice time, including 2:48 with the man advantage. If he couldn’t reach the 40-point mark with that generous workload, then there’s no reason to believe he’ll do so in 2025-26. Read Past Outlooks
Gets lone goal against former team
Wennberg scored a power-play goal in Saturday's 4-1 loss to the Kraken.
ANALYSIS
Wennberg was able to score against one of his former teams, tying the game at 1-1 late in the first period. Matt Murray (lower body) was injured on the play, but Philipp Grubauer kept the Sharks off the board the rest of the way. Wennberg has emerged as a steady veteran in a top-six role this season, collecting five goals and 11 points over 19 appearances. He's added 20 shots on net, 24 blocked shots and a minus-5 rating. With eight of his points coming in the last 10 games, Wennberg is worth a look in fantasy until the offense dries up.

Wennberg provided 10 goals and 30 points in 79 regular-season games between Seattle and the Rangers last season. It was the third straight campaign in which he finished with 30-40 points, so his performance can't be seen as surprising. Sure, Wennberg had 13 goals and 59 points across 80 appearances with Columbus in 2016-17, but it looks like that campaign will go down as the high-water mark of Wennberg's career. The 29-year-old (30 on Sept. 22) signed with San Jose over the summer and will likely serve as the second or third-line center. In either role, he's unlikely to exceed the 40-point mark this year. Even in leagues that value faceoffs, his use is limited. He is likely to take a lot of draws, but his career 46.2 winning percentage is nothing to get excited over.
